  • ingnition systems ...89 carb....

    does someone know witch performance ignition systems fit 89 carb festiva's and what do you think about replacing the mechanical fuel pump
    and put an electric Jackson racing for example.....

    thanks....

  • #2
    The stock Festiva engine really isn't worth the time and cost of adding performance parts to.

    The best thing to do if you want a fast Festiva is yank the stock B3 engine out and replace it with a B6 which is almost a bolt in swap.

      ditto...if you really wanna improve it though, just swap out the coil for a msd blaser 2 coil and get some decent plugs and plug wires...you'll notice an improvement.

        oh yeah and i run an electric fuel pump on my carbed festy, it's a major pita because you have the vapor line to worry about. i was just too lazy to swap the cams out when i put the fi engine in(cam doesn't have a lobe for the fuel pump) and you'll also needa block off plate for the puel pump, can get one off any fuel injected festiva or aspire.
